Released in 1976 and directed by John Schlesinger, the film follows "Babe" (Dustin Hoffman), a graduate student and runner who becomes entangled in a deadly plot involving a Nazi war criminal, Szell (Laurence Olivier), seeking a hidden stash of diamonds.
